Job Description

Our client is an entertainment group in Saudi Arabia, operating across live events, music, venues, and hospitality, with a growing regional and global presence. They are seeking a Group Marketing Director to be based in KSA, responsible for leading and transforming the marketing function at a group level. This role is critical in unifying a fragmented structure, elevating brand positioning, and delivering high-impact campaigns across a dynamic event calendar. Success will be defined by the ability to integrate multiple marketing streams, lead large-scale campaigns, and drive consistent, commercially aligned brand growth. This is a director-level, strategic and hands-on leadership role with full ownership of group-wide marketing across events, venues, and music verticals. The role will focus on brand-led storytelling, campaign execution, and artist-driven marketing, while building structure, governance, and performance discipline across the function. The successful candidate will operate in a fast-paced, high-visibility environment, working closely with senior leadership, creative stakeholders, and external agencies to deliver best-in-class marketing outcomes.
